Thank you, I will give that a shot!  :)<br><br>Shane<br><br><br><div class="gmail_quote">On Tue, Feb 2, 2010 at 10:59 AM, Raphael Ritz <span dir="ltr">&lt;<a href="mailto:r.ritz@biologie.hu-berlin.de">r.ritz@biologie.hu-berlin.de</a>&gt;</span> wrote:<br>

<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div class="im">Shane Graber wrote:<br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
I have a couple products that I&#39;m writing that install portlets and custom views for certain content items.  Is there a way for me to flag that a product is being re-installed in the install/uninstall routine?  The way it&#39;s written now, it installs (adding portlets and views as needed) and uninstalls (removes portlets and resets all views to their defaults prior to installation).  What I want is some short of flag that I can set in Extensions/Install.py to flag that it&#39;s being reinstalled so that it does not remove the portlets and already set views.<br>


<br>
Is there a way to do that?  Any code would be appreciated.  Thanks!<br>
</blockquote>
<br></div>
IIRC the install/uninstall methods invoked by the quickinstaller<br>
take an optional argument &quot;reinstall=True&quot; (default false) that<br>
QI (should) use to leave a few things untouched already on reinstall<br>
(available from ZMI). You should be able to check for that flag<br>
and have it set when you invoke &#39;reinstall&#39; in ZMI.<br>
<br>
Raphael<br>
<br>
<br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<br>
Shane<br>
<br>
<br>
------------------------------------------------------------------------<br>
<br>
_______________________________________________<br>
Product-Developers mailing list<br>
<a href="mailto:Product-Developers@lists.plone.org" target="_blank">Product-Developers@lists.plone.org</a><br>
<a href="http://lists.plone.org/mailman/listinfo/product-developers" target="_blank">http://lists.plone.org/mailman/listinfo/product-developers</a><br>
</blockquote>
<br>
<br>
_______________________________________________<br>
Product-Developers mailing list<br>
<a href="mailto:Product-Developers@lists.plone.org" target="_blank">Product-Developers@lists.plone.org</a><br>
<a href="http://lists.plone.org/mailman/listinfo/product-developers" target="_blank">http://lists.plone.org/mailman/listinfo/product-developers</a><br>
</blockquote></div><br><br clear="all"><br>-- <br>Shane  ∞  <a href="http://google.com/profiles/sgraber">http://google.com/profiles/sgraber</a><br>---------<br>I&#39;m so cool I can be used to prove Bose-Einstein Condensation!<br>